The beneficiaries of the Pantawid Pamilya Pilipino Program (4Ps) of The Department of Social Welfare and Development (DSWD)  in Region II received their first rice subsidy pay-out during the simultaneous pay-outs conducted across the region in March, 2017.

 

The amount of six hundred pesos (PhP 600.00) was included over and above the regular cash grant of three hundred pesos (PhP 300.00) per child for a maximum of three children as educational grant and five hundred pesos (PhP 500.00) per household as health grant for each compliant household.

 

Compliance on the conditions includes school attendance of at least 85% per month for children enrolled in elementary or highschool; Children aged 5 and below would need to undergo preventive check-up as mandated by the Department of Health; Elementary children should be dewormed twice within the school year; Pregnant women must receive pre and post natal care based on DOH’s protocol; and the parents or guardians should attend the monthly family development sessions.

 

The said rice subsidy was  in fulfilment of the declaration made by President Rodrigo Roa Duterte in his first State of the Nation Address (SONA) on July 25, 2016.

 

Secretary Judy M. Taguiwalo of the Department reiterates that the rice subsidy shall be given in cash as included in the P72,115,230.00 cash grant budget approved for calendar year 2017.

 

 

“We are hopeful that the additional cash grant will be used for its intended purpose. We will use FDS to ensure that the beneficiaries are informed of the relevant provision on rice subsidy,” concluded by Sec. Taguiwalo.
